Output 5f8175fa3d9db228a7bb6757d41f89f612a92129138c817eaba526e1e883f718:32

value
34923470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578abfda05defb3612b4751eab96fe6c08583b7c OP_EQUAL
address
39ftviEZyujFQUaH5ovvGqzwZzwEc4ep6j
transaction
5f8175fa3d9db228a7bb6757d41f89f612a92129138c817eaba526e1e883f718
spent
true